Consonants / Las consonantes Spanish spelling is pretty consistent: most letters represent a single sound regardless of their position in a word. Note the following peculiarities: H - La hache is never pronounced. Thus, words like Honduras, ahora and alcohol have no aspiration before the /o/ sound. CH - la che is always pronounced as in cheers: coche, ocho. La hache is not combined with any other consonants: no th, sh, ph, gh, etc. (English ph may translate to f: filosofía, Filadelfia). C - la ce is pronounced /k/ (as in case) in most positions: caso, cosa, cuota, frecuente, crisis. Before -e, -i, it is pronounced /s/ (as in sin) in America or /th/ (as in thin) in Spain: cielo, acento. The /k/ sound (as in kiss), is spelled qu (mute u) before -e,-i: queso, quince. G - la ge is pronounced /g/ (as in go) in most positions: gala, gota, guante, globo. Before -e, -i, it is pronounced almost like /h/ (as in hen): general, gitano. The /g/ sound (as in get), is spelled gu (mute u) before -e,-i: guerra, guitarra. If the letter u is to be pronounced in a gue/gui combination, it is marked with a diaeresis (la diéresis): pingüino, bilingüe, nicaragüense. Q - la cu is used only in the que/qui combinations, and the u is always mute in this position. Therefore, English quota and frequent translate to cuota and frecuente, and the word quinteto has no /u/ sound. Z - la zeta is pronounced /s/ in America and /th/ in Spain. Spanish avoids the ze/zi combination and prefers ce, ci: lápiz -- lápices; cebra, cenit.
